GitLab units, metrics, and properties

GitLab units, metrics, and properties

GitLab units, metrics, and properties

This page describes the available units, metrics, and issue properties when creating a chart for a GitLab data source.

See also these related resources
Chart editor guide
Screenful Knowledge base

Units

Units are the numbers shown in the charts. Unit can be any of these:

Issues and MRs

By default, charts display the count of issues, tasks, and merge requests.

Hours

GitLab's estimate field in the time tracking feature.

Points

GitLab issue weight

Time in state

Timing metrics (reaction, lead, cycle time). These are calculated for all issues, tasks, and merge requests.

All units share these characteristics:

  • They can be filtered by any property of an issue

  • They can be summarized as sum, average, or median

  • They can be formatted as numbers, monetary units, or time units


Metrics

Metrics are the calculations performed on the selected unit.

Total

Shows the total amount of the selected unit in the selected data sources.

Not started

Work not started according to the workflow settings.

Not started & In progress

Incomplete work according to the workflow settings.

In progress

Work in progress according to the workflow settings.

Created (within date range)

Issues by creation date (issue creation date from the Linear API).

Completed (within date range)

Issues by Date completed. The last date & time when the issue was completed (moved to a state mapped as done in the workflow settings).

By Due date

Issues by Due date. Includes the items that have a Due date within the selected date range (regardless of their workflow state).

Reaction time (avg, completed items)

Time before the work was started. The average time spent in the states mapped as Not started in the workflow settings.

Reaction time (sum, completed items)

Time before the work was started. The sum of time spent in the states mapped as Not started in the workflow settings.

Cycle time (avg, completed items)

Time from start to completion. The average time spent in the states mapped as In progress in the workflow settings.

Cycle time (sum, completed items)

Time from start to completion The sum of time spent in the states mapped as In progress in the workflow settings.

Lead time (avg, completed items)

Lead time (avg) = (Reaction time + Cycle time) (avg)

Lead time (sum, completed items)

Lead time (sum) = (Reaction time + Cycle time) (sum)

Time in state (avg, completed items)

Time spent in specific workflow states. Use the filter to select the states.

Time in state (sum, completed items)

Time spent in specific workflow states. Use the filter to select the states.


Issue properties

Issue properties that can be displayed as columns in a Task list.

Assignee

The assigned person

Assignees

The assigned persons (if multiple)

Completed on time

Was the item completed before the due date (true/false).

Created by

The person who created the issue.

Cycle time

Time from start to completion. The time spent in the states mapped as In progress in the workflow settings.

Cycle time (working hours)

Time from start to completion. The time spent in the states mapped as In progress in the workflow settings. Time is calculated only within the set working days and hours.

Data source

The GitLab board the item is currently in.

Date completed

The last date & time when the issue was completed (moved to a state mapped as done in the workflow settings).

Date created

Item creation date (from the Linear API).

Date updated

Last update date (from the Linear API)

Due date

Issue Due date.

Epic

The Epic the issue is assigned to

Estimate

GitLab issue weight

GitLab ID

GitLab's autoincrement ID

Issue or MR ID

Unique identifier of the issue (from the GitLab API).

Issue or MR name

Name of the issue, task, or merge request.

Item type

Issue, task, or merge request.

Iteration

The current iteration of the issue, task, or merge request

Label

The labels added to the issue.

Lead time

Reaction time + Cycle time

Lead time (working hours)

Reaction time + Cycle time. Time is calculated only within the set working days and hours.

Mapped state

Mapped workflow state according to the workflow settings. Either Not started, In progress, or Done.

Milestone

The assigned milestone of the issue, task, or merge request

Moved to mapped state

Time when the item was moved to its current mapped workflow state.

Moved to workflow state

Time when the item was moved to its current workflow state.

Original estimate

GitLab's estimate field in the time tracking feature.

Project

The prroject the issue, task, or merge request is currently assigned to.

Reaction time

Time before the work was started. The time spent in the states mapped as Not started in the workflow settings.

Reaction time (working hours)

Time before the work was started. The time spent in the states mapped as Not started in the workflow settings. Time is calculated only within the set working days and hours.

Reopened

Whether the issue has been reopened (true/false)

Start date

The set start date of the issue

State

The issue workflow state

State (open/done)

Whether the issue's mapped state is Open (Not started or In progress) or Done.

Team

The team the issue is assigned to.

Time in progress

The time spent in the states mapped as In progress in the workflow settings.

Time in progress (working hours)

The time spent in the states mapped as In progress in the workflow settings. Time is calculated only within the set working days and hours.

Time in workflow state

The time spent in the current workflow state.

Timings

The total time spent in each workflow state.

Work done

The Spent field from GItLab time tracking feature

Work left

The remaining estimated time from GitLab time tracking feature.

Workflow state

The current workflow state of the issue.


This page describes the available units, metrics, and issue properties when creating a chart for a GitLab data source.

See also these related resources
Chart editor guide
Screenful Knowledge base

Units

Units are the numbers shown in the charts. Unit can be any of these:

Issues and MRs

By default, charts display the count of issues, tasks, and merge requests.

Hours

GitLab's estimate field in the time tracking feature.

Points

GitLab issue weight

Time in state

Timing metrics (reaction, lead, cycle time). These are calculated for all issues, tasks, and merge requests.

All units share these characteristics:

  • They can be filtered by any property of an issue

  • They can be summarized as sum, average, or median

  • They can be formatted as numbers, monetary units, or time units


Metrics

Metrics are the calculations performed on the selected unit.

Total

Shows the total amount of the selected unit in the selected data sources.

Not started

Work not started according to the workflow settings.

Not started & In progress

Incomplete work according to the workflow settings.

In progress

Work in progress according to the workflow settings.

Created (within date range)

Issues by creation date (issue creation date from the Linear API).

Completed (within date range)

Issues by Date completed. The last date & time when the issue was completed (moved to a state mapped as done in the workflow settings).

By Due date

Issues by Due date. Includes the items that have a Due date within the selected date range (regardless of their workflow state).

Reaction time (avg, completed items)

Time before the work was started. The average time spent in the states mapped as Not started in the workflow settings.

Reaction time (sum, completed items)

Time before the work was started. The sum of time spent in the states mapped as Not started in the workflow settings.

Cycle time (avg, completed items)

Time from start to completion. The average time spent in the states mapped as In progress in the workflow settings.

Cycle time (sum, completed items)

Time from start to completion The sum of time spent in the states mapped as In progress in the workflow settings.

Lead time (avg, completed items)

Lead time (avg) = (Reaction time + Cycle time) (avg)

Lead time (sum, completed items)

Lead time (sum) = (Reaction time + Cycle time) (sum)

Time in state (avg, completed items)

Time spent in specific workflow states. Use the filter to select the states.

Time in state (sum, completed items)

Time spent in specific workflow states. Use the filter to select the states.


Issue properties

Issue properties that can be displayed as columns in a Task list.

Assignee

The assigned person

Assignees

The assigned persons (if multiple)

Completed on time

Was the item completed before the due date (true/false).

Created by

The person who created the issue.

Cycle time

Time from start to completion. The time spent in the states mapped as In progress in the workflow settings.

Cycle time (working hours)

Time from start to completion. The time spent in the states mapped as In progress in the workflow settings. Time is calculated only within the set working days and hours.

Data source

The GitLab board the item is currently in.

Date completed

The last date & time when the issue was completed (moved to a state mapped as done in the workflow settings).

Date created

Item creation date (from the Linear API).

Date updated

Last update date (from the Linear API)

Due date

Issue Due date.

Epic

The Epic the issue is assigned to

Estimate

GitLab issue weight

GitLab ID

GitLab's autoincrement ID

Issue or MR ID

Unique identifier of the issue (from the GitLab API).

Issue or MR name

Name of the issue, task, or merge request.

Item type

Issue, task, or merge request.

Iteration

The current iteration of the issue, task, or merge request

Label

The labels added to the issue.

Lead time

Reaction time + Cycle time

Lead time (working hours)

Reaction time + Cycle time. Time is calculated only within the set working days and hours.

Mapped state

Mapped workflow state according to the workflow settings. Either Not started, In progress, or Done.

Milestone

The assigned milestone of the issue, task, or merge request

Moved to mapped state

Time when the item was moved to its current mapped workflow state.

Moved to workflow state

Time when the item was moved to its current workflow state.

Original estimate

GitLab's estimate field in the time tracking feature.

Project

The prroject the issue, task, or merge request is currently assigned to.

Reaction time

Time before the work was started. The time spent in the states mapped as Not started in the workflow settings.

Reaction time (working hours)

Time before the work was started. The time spent in the states mapped as Not started in the workflow settings. Time is calculated only within the set working days and hours.

Reopened

Whether the issue has been reopened (true/false)

Start date

The set start date of the issue

State

The issue workflow state

State (open/done)

Whether the issue's mapped state is Open (Not started or In progress) or Done.

Team

The team the issue is assigned to.

Time in progress

The time spent in the states mapped as In progress in the workflow settings.

Time in progress (working hours)

The time spent in the states mapped as In progress in the workflow settings. Time is calculated only within the set working days and hours.

Time in workflow state

The time spent in the current workflow state.

Timings

The total time spent in each workflow state.

Work done

The Spent field from GItLab time tracking feature

Work left

The remaining estimated time from GitLab time tracking feature.

Workflow state

The current workflow state of the issue.


This page describes the available units, metrics, and issue properties when creating a chart for a GitLab data source.

See also these related resources
Chart editor guide
Screenful Knowledge base

Units

Units are the numbers shown in the charts. Unit can be any of these:

Issues and MRs

By default, charts display the count of issues, tasks, and merge requests.

Hours

GitLab's estimate field in the time tracking feature.

Points

GitLab issue weight

Time in state

Timing metrics (reaction, lead, cycle time). These are calculated for all issues, tasks, and merge requests.

All units share these characteristics:

  • They can be filtered by any property of an issue

  • They can be summarized as sum, average, or median

  • They can be formatted as numbers, monetary units, or time units


Metrics

Metrics are the calculations performed on the selected unit.

Total

Shows the total amount of the selected unit in the selected data sources.

Not started

Work not started according to the workflow settings.

Not started & In progress

Incomplete work according to the workflow settings.

In progress

Work in progress according to the workflow settings.

Created (within date range)

Issues by creation date (issue creation date from the Linear API).

Completed (within date range)

Issues by Date completed. The last date & time when the issue was completed (moved to a state mapped as done in the workflow settings).

By Due date

Issues by Due date. Includes the items that have a Due date within the selected date range (regardless of their workflow state).

Reaction time (avg, completed items)

Time before the work was started. The average time spent in the states mapped as Not started in the workflow settings.

Reaction time (sum, completed items)

Time before the work was started. The sum of time spent in the states mapped as Not started in the workflow settings.

Cycle time (avg, completed items)

Time from start to completion. The average time spent in the states mapped as In progress in the workflow settings.

Cycle time (sum, completed items)

Time from start to completion The sum of time spent in the states mapped as In progress in the workflow settings.

Lead time (avg, completed items)

Lead time (avg) = (Reaction time + Cycle time) (avg)

Lead time (sum, completed items)

Lead time (sum) = (Reaction time + Cycle time) (sum)

Time in state (avg, completed items)

Time spent in specific workflow states. Use the filter to select the states.

Time in state (sum, completed items)

Time spent in specific workflow states. Use the filter to select the states.


Issue properties

Issue properties that can be displayed as columns in a Task list.

Assignee

The assigned person

Assignees

The assigned persons (if multiple)

Completed on time

Was the item completed before the due date (true/false).

Created by

The person who created the issue.

Cycle time

Time from start to completion. The time spent in the states mapped as In progress in the workflow settings.

Cycle time (working hours)

Time from start to completion. The time spent in the states mapped as In progress in the workflow settings. Time is calculated only within the set working days and hours.

Data source

The GitLab board the item is currently in.

Date completed

The last date & time when the issue was completed (moved to a state mapped as done in the workflow settings).

Date created

Item creation date (from the Linear API).

Date updated

Last update date (from the Linear API)

Due date

Issue Due date.

Epic

The Epic the issue is assigned to

Estimate

GitLab issue weight

GitLab ID

GitLab's autoincrement ID

Issue or MR ID

Unique identifier of the issue (from the GitLab API).

Issue or MR name

Name of the issue, task, or merge request.

Item type

Issue, task, or merge request.

Iteration

The current iteration of the issue, task, or merge request

Label

The labels added to the issue.

Lead time

Reaction time + Cycle time

Lead time (working hours)

Reaction time + Cycle time. Time is calculated only within the set working days and hours.

Mapped state

Mapped workflow state according to the workflow settings. Either Not started, In progress, or Done.

Milestone

The assigned milestone of the issue, task, or merge request

Moved to mapped state

Time when the item was moved to its current mapped workflow state.

Moved to workflow state

Time when the item was moved to its current workflow state.

Original estimate

GitLab's estimate field in the time tracking feature.

Project

The prroject the issue, task, or merge request is currently assigned to.

Reaction time

Time before the work was started. The time spent in the states mapped as Not started in the workflow settings.

Reaction time (working hours)

Time before the work was started. The time spent in the states mapped as Not started in the workflow settings. Time is calculated only within the set working days and hours.

Reopened

Whether the issue has been reopened (true/false)

Start date

The set start date of the issue

State

The issue workflow state

State (open/done)

Whether the issue's mapped state is Open (Not started or In progress) or Done.

Team

The team the issue is assigned to.

Time in progress

The time spent in the states mapped as In progress in the workflow settings.

Time in progress (working hours)

The time spent in the states mapped as In progress in the workflow settings. Time is calculated only within the set working days and hours.

Time in workflow state

The time spent in the current workflow state.

Timings

The total time spent in each workflow state.

Work done

The Spent field from GItLab time tracking feature

Work left

The remaining estimated time from GitLab time tracking feature.

Workflow state

The current workflow state of the issue.